Why is my cat's third eyelid red and he has yellow watery diarrhea?

Hi, for the past 2-3 days I noticed my cat nictitating membrane appear suddenly and it quite red and today the cat got diarrhea. Yellow colour watery stool. What's happening actually. I'm worried right now.

Any time you can see a cat's third eyelid, it is generally a sign they do feel well for whatever reason. In your case, it must have been a GI upset to cause the diarrhea. This can be from an infection, parasites or food. I would recommend seeing an emergency clinic since it has started a few days to get some testing done and antibiotics or probiotics to add to the food. They may want to try a sensitive stomach formula food to help until things get back to normal

    It looks like she could have Haw's syndrome which can be caused by inflammation in the cat's intestines. A common reason is parasites (usually tapeworms), so it would be a great idea to deworm your cat with a tapeworm dewormer for cats. Your vet should be able to give you a prescription, if needed. If the problem persists or gets worse then she needs to be examined by a vet. You could also have your vet test a stool sample to make sure she doesn't have additional parasites.
